Apple Pie Bread with Streusel Topping

This Apple Pie Bread with Streusel Topping combines the best of apple pie and a cozy homemade loaf. Packed with grated apples and warm spices, and topped with a crunchy, sweet crumble, this bread is perfect for breakfast, dessert, or a midday snack. The aroma of cinnamon, nutmeg, and ginger fills your kitchen as it bakes, making it an irresistible treat for any time of the year.

Ingredients

Crumble Topping:

  • 3 tablespoons unsalted butter, melted
  • ⅓ to ½ cup all-purpose flour, plus 1 to 2 tablespoons more if needed
  • 2 tablespoons granulated sugar
  • 2 tablespoons light brown sugar, packed
  • 1 teaspoon cinnamon
  • ¼ to ½ teaspoon salt, or to taste

Bread:

  • 1 large egg
  • ½ cup light brown sugar, packed
  • ⅓ cup canola, vegetable, or liquid-state coconut oil
  • ⅓ cup granulated sugar
  • ¼ cup sour cream or Greek yogurt (use varieties with fat in them)
  • 2 teaspoons vanilla extract
  • 2 teaspoons cinnamon
  • 1 teaspoon ground ginger, or to taste
  • ½ teaspoon ground nutmeg, or to taste
  • 1 ½ cups all-purpose flour
  • ½ teaspoon baking powder
  • ½ teaspoon baking soda
  • ½ teaspoon salt, or to taste
  • 1 ½ cups grated apples, peeled first (Granny Smith, Fuji, Gala, Honeycrisp, or similar varieties)

Instructions

Prepare the Oven and Pan:

  1. Preheat oven to 350°F. Spray a 9×5-inch loaf pan very well with floured cooking spray or grease and flour the pan; set aside.

Make the Crumble Topping:

  1. In a medium bowl, add the melted butter, ⅓ cup flour, sugars, cinnamon, and salt. Lightly fluff with a fork to combine until small marbles and pebbles form. If the topping is too wet and resembles wet sand rather than small pebbles, add additional flour up to ½ cup total to achieve the desired consistency. Set aside.

Make the Bread:

  1. In a large bowl, whisk together the egg, brown sugar, oil, granulated sugar, sour cream or Greek yogurt, vanilla, cinnamon, ginger, and nutmeg until well combined.
  2. Add the flour, baking powder, baking soda, and salt. Fold with a spatula or stir gently with a spoon until just combined; avoid overmixing.
  3. Fold in the grated apples gently.
  4. Pour the batter into the prepared pan, smoothing the top lightly with a spatula.
  5. Evenly sprinkle the reserved crumble topping over the batter.

Bake the Bread:

  1. Bake for about 45 to 52 minutes (I baked for 48 minutes), or until a toothpick inserted in the center comes out clean or with a few moist crumbs, but no batter. Tip: Tent the pan with a sheet of foil draped loosely over it at the 30 to 35-minute mark to prevent the tops and sides from becoming too browned before the center cooks through.
  2. Allow the bread to cool in the pan for about 30 minutes before turning out onto a wire rack to cool completely before slicing and serving.

Tips

  • Apple Varieties: Granny Smith apples add a nice tartness, while Fuji or Honeycrisp provide a sweeter taste. Choose according to your preference.
  • Mixing: Overmixing the batter can lead to dense bread. Stir until ingredients are just combined.
  • Tent Foil: Tenting with foil helps ensure the bread cooks evenly without the exterior becoming too dark.
  • Serving: This bread is delicious on its own or with a spread of butter or cream cheese.
